Esempio n. 1
0
        public void Filter()
        {
            XDoc doc = new XDoc("test").Elem("a", "1").Elem("a", "2").Elem("a", "3").Elem("a", "4").Elem("a", "5");

            doc.Filter(delegate(XDoc item) { return((item.AsInt ?? 0) % 2 == 0); });
            string text = doc.ToString();

            Assert.AreEqual("<test><a>2</a><a>4</a></test>", text);
        }
Esempio n. 2
0
 public void Filter()
 {
     XDoc doc = new XDoc("test").Elem("a", "1").Elem("a", "2").Elem("a", "3").Elem("a", "4").Elem("a", "5");
     doc.Filter(delegate(XDoc item) { return (item.AsInt ?? 0) % 2 == 0; });
     string text = doc.ToString();
     Assert.AreEqual("<test><a>2</a><a>4</a></test>", text);
 }